Germany boosts sown area of winter rapeseed for 2026 crop
According to the German Union for the Promotion of Oilseed and Grain Cultivation (UFOP), winter rapeseed acreage in Germany has increased to between 1.10 and 1.15 million hectares, up to 60,000 hectares more than the 2025 target.
Experts attribute the expansion to last year’s high yields and favorable weather conditions in late August and early September. In most regions, crops are developing in good or very good condition, but an increase in the number of pyrethroid-resistant rapeseed weevils has been observed.
UFOP warns that pest control is becoming more difficult due to growing resistance and calls for accelerated registration of new plant protection products.
Despite localized reseeding, the overall situation in the fields is assessed as stable. Experts expect that with sufficient rainfall and sunny weather, the rapeseed harvest in 2026 could be high.
